MASTERING YOUR BERNINA® BERNINA® 009DCC MOCK FLAT FELLED SEAM Fabric: Needle: Thread: Presser Foot: Medium weight cotton twill, 4" x 6" 80/12 Universal 3 cones of serger thread Coverstitch Owner's manual pg.___ • Following the instructions in the manual (page ___), thread the serger for cover stitch using thread colors to match the color-coded threading path on the serger (use blue for purple markings). • Fold the fabric to form a ½" tuck lengthwise through the center of the fabric. • Center the fabric under the presser foot. Lift the presser foot and place the fabric completely under the foot, with the bulk of the fold to the left. Align the folded edge with the inside of the right floating toe of the presser foot. • Coverstitch, forming a tuck along the edge of the fabric. Serge to the end of the fabric. • At the end of the stitching, turn the handwheel counterclockwise until the needles are at their lowest position. Then turn the handwheel clockwise until the needles are at their highest position to release the threads from the looper. • Raise the presser foot and carefully remove the work. Cut the thread using the thread cutter. • Trim and mount the sample. MASTERING YOUR BERNINA® 1/04/02 009DCC/5
